Effective Manager

A 3 day Management Training Course focusing on key personal and interpersonal skills

Many AtLast! clients regard this course as an essential part of any development programme for their managers. It focuses on developing the key personal and interpersonal skills which are consistently demonstrated by all successful managers and which allows them to achieve results through other people.

 

DESIGNED FOR

Managers, employers, and business principals with more than 3 years experience of managing three or more people. Typical job titles of participants are centre manager, regional manager, production manager, unit manager, or owner.

 

BENEFITS

As a result of this course, participants will be able to:

    •    Describe the core principals of management and develop key actions to improve performance
    •    Describe the principles of motivation and identify actions to enhance the commitment and performance of others
    •    Select an appropriate style of management dependent on the situation
    •    Set clear objectives for themselves and others
    •    Use a range of communication skills to achieve positive results

 

CONTENT 

Management Skills - Defining the essentials
 
Motivation in theory and practice - How behaviour affects others.  Identifying actions to improve motivation in the workplace

Managing the performance of others - Planning, allocating work, and monitoring performance.  Setting objectives.
 
Management style - Preferences and options.  The use of power and influence.  The use of delegation.
 
Leadership and teamwork - Role of the leader and working in a team
 
Communicating effectively - Creating, maintaining and enhancing effective working relationships with staff, colleagues and more senior managers.  Handling difficult situations including grievances and discipline.  Exchanging information to solve problems and make decisions, for example, in meetings and discussions.
